Expand description
Describes a data source.
Fields (Non-exhaustive)
This struct is marked as non-exhaustive
Struct { .. }
syntax; cannot be matched against without a wildcard ..
; and struct update syntax will not work.data_source_arn: Option<String>
The data source Amazon Resource Name (ARN).
name: Option<String>
The name of the data source.
description: Option<String>
The description of the data source.
type: Option<DataSourceType>
The type of the data source.
-
AWS_LAMBDA: The data source is an Lambda function.
-
AMAZON_DYNAMODB: The data source is an Amazon DynamoDB table.
-
AMAZON_ELASTICSEARCH: The data source is an Amazon OpenSearch Service domain.
-
AMAZON_OPENSEARCH_SERVICE: The data source is an Amazon OpenSearch Service domain.
-
NONE: There is no data source. Use this type when you want to invoke a GraphQL operation without connecting to a data source, such as when you're performing data transformation with resolvers or invoking a subscription from a mutation.
-
HTTP: The data source is an HTTP endpoint.
-
RELATIONAL_DATABASE: The data source is a relational database.
service_role_arn: Option<String>
The Identity and Access Management (IAM) service role Amazon Resource Name (ARN) for the data source. The system assumes this role when accessing the data source.
dynamodb_config: Option<DynamodbDataSourceConfig>
DynamoDB settings.
lambda_config: Option<LambdaDataSourceConfig>
Lambda settings.
elasticsearch_config: Option<ElasticsearchDataSourceConfig>
Amazon OpenSearch Service settings.
open_search_service_config: Option<OpenSearchServiceDataSourceConfig>
Amazon OpenSearch Service settings.
http_config: Option<HttpDataSourceConfig>
HTTP endpoint settings.
relational_database_config: Option<RelationalDatabaseDataSourceConfig>
Relational database settings.
